.ReviewsSection_marketing-reviews-section__RQKef{height:100%}.ReviewsSection_marketing-reviews-section__image__kjWjh{height:40px;-o-object-fit:contain;object-fit:contain}.ReviewsSection_reviewWrapper__5SoVc.ReviewsSection_marketing-reviews-section__heading__LTCtk{font-family:var(--brand-typo_font-family--primary_medium);font-size:var(--brand-typo_heading-1-font-size);font-weight:var(--brand-typo_font-weight--medium);line-height:var(--brand-typo_heading-2-line-height)}@media (min-width:1536px){.ReviewsSection_reviewWrapper__5SoVc.ReviewsSection_marketing-reviews-section__heading__LTCtk{font-size:var(--brand-typo_heading-2-font-size);line-height:var(--brand-typo_heading-2-line-height)}}.dist_marketing-review__NOUE3{align-items:center;background:var(--marketing-cream-100,#fffdf6);border-bottom-right-radius:var(--brand-rounded-x5,1.25rem);display:flex;flex-direction:column;gap:var(--brand-spacing_6,1.5rem);justify-content:flex-start;padding:var(--brand-spacing_6,1.5rem);text-align:center}.dist_marketing-review__heading__LO1nm{color:var(--marketing-charcoal-grey-900,#1b1b1b)}.dist_marketing-review__wrapper__nudFv{display:flex;flex-direction:column;gap:var(--brand-spacing_8,2rem);justify-content:center;list-style:none;margin:0;overflow:hidden;padding:0;width:100%}.dist_marketing-review__container__hHapO{color:var(--marketing-forest-green-900,#004228);display:flex;fill:var(--marketing-forest-green-900,#004228);flex-direction:column;gap:.25rem;justify-self:flex-start}.dist_marketing-review__ratings__ocLYA{align-items:center;display:grid;grid-gap:var(--brand-spacing_4,1rem);gap:var(--brand-spacing_4,1rem);grid-template-columns:repeat(2,1fr);justify-items:center}.dist_marketing-review__logo__U8i4I{justify-self:flex-end;width:130px}.dist_marketing-review__stars__5Eqy8{display:inline-flex;gap:.375rem}.dist_marketing-review__link__VNW84:focus-visible{border-radius:var(--brand-rounded-x4,1rem);outline:var(--marketing-iris-purple-400,#8b83e7) solid 2px;outline-offset:1px}@media (min-width:360px){.dist_marketing-review__ratings__ocLYA{gap:var(--brand-spacing_6,1.5rem)}}@media (min-width:768px){.dist_marketing-review__reviews__UgJ35{flex-direction:row}.dist_marketing-review__ratings__ocLYA{gap:var(--brand-spacing_10,2.5rem)}}@media (min-width:1024px){.dist_marketing-review__NOUE3{border-bottom-right-radius:var(--brand-rounded-x10,2.5rem);gap:var(--brand-spacing_10,2.5rem);padding:var(--brand-spacing_8,2rem)}.dist_marketing-review__heading__LO1nm{max-width:600px}.dist_marketing-review__ratings__ocLYA{gap:var(--brand-spacing_2,.5rem)}.dist_marketing-review__wrapper--row__9REKQ{flex-direction:row;gap:var(--brand-spacing_16,4rem)}}@media (min-width:1280px){.dist_marketing-review__heading__LO1nm{max-width:760px}}@media (min-width:1536px){.dist_marketing-review__heading__LO1nm{max-width:960px}}.HomePage_marketing-homepage-hero__6Zc9x{padding-top:var(--brand-spacing_6,1.5rem);height:100%;width:100%;position:relative;text-align:center}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__6Zc9x{padding-top:var(--brand-spacing_16,4rem)}}.HomePage_marketing-homepage-hero__backdrop__HQXz7{position:absolute;top:0;left:0;right:0;height:80%;border-bottom-left-radius:var(--brand-rounded-x10,2.5rem);border-bottom-right-radius:var(--brand-rounded-x10,2.5rem)}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__backdrop__HQXz7{height:70%;border-bottom-left-radius:var(--brand-rounded-x20,5rem);border-bottom-right-radius:var(--brand-rounded-x20,5rem)}}@media screen and (min-width:1280px){.HomePage_marketing-homepage-hero__backdrop__HQXz7{border-bottom-left-radius:6.25rem;border-bottom-right-radius:6.25rem}}@media screen and (min-width:1536px){.HomePage_marketing-homepage-hero__backdrop__HQXz7{border-bottom-left-radius:7.5rem;border-bottom-right-radius:7.5rem}}.HomePage_marketing-homepage-hero__container__lfbRZ{position:relative}.HomePage_marketing-homepage-hero__content__pzwYK,.HomePage_marketing-homepage-hero__inner__bDSdP{display:flex;flex-direction:column;align-items:center;gap:var(--brand-spacing_6,1.5rem)}.HomePage_marketing-homepage-hero__content__pzwYK{width:100%}.HomePage_marketing-homepage-hero__document__wJRVR{display:flex;flex-direction:column;align-items:center;gap:var(--brand-spacing_2,.5rem);width:100%}.HomePage_marketing-homepage-hero__title__Xj8hP{width:100%;display:flex;flex-direction:column;align-items:center;justify-content:center;max-width:900px}.HomePage_marketing-homepage-hero__title__Xj8hP span{display:block}.HomePage_marketing-homepage-hero__title--forest-green__xKpNX span,.HomePage_marketing-homepage-hero__title--mint-green__SycLw span{color:var(--marketing-forest-green-800,#006a43)}.HomePage_marketing-homepage-hero__title--iris-purple__TAfBd span{color:var(--marketing-iris-purple-900,#3b3585)}.HomePage_marketing-homepage-hero__title--coral-orange__AoXWK span{color:var(--marketing-coral-orange-800,#bc4f2d)}.HomePage_marketing-homepage-hero__title--aqua-teal__aG7tC span{color:var(--marketing-aqua-teal-800,#116b6b)}.HomePage_marketing-homepage-hero__title--peony-pink___Z2hK span{color:var(--marketing-peony-pink-900,#b22557)}.HomePage_marketing-homepage-hero__text__uWP1N{margin-bottom:0}.HomePage_marketing-homepage-hero__text__uWP1N ul{list-style-type:disc;margin-top:var(--brand-spacing_4,1rem);margin-bottom:var(--brand-spacing_0,0);display:flex;flex-direction:column;gap:var(--brand-spacing_1,.25rem);justify-content:center;padding-left:var(--brand-spacing_6,1.5rem);align-items:flex-start;text-align:left}.HomePage_marketing-homepage-hero__text-btm__JB6Ej{color:var(--marketing-charcoal-grey-900,#1b1b1b);margin-top:var(--brand-rounded-x2,.5rem);opacity:.5}.HomePage_marketing-homepage-hero__text-btm--dark__uUvkw{color:var(--marketing-white,#fff)}.HomePage_marketing-homepage-hero__cta__lg0vS{display:flex;flex-direction:column;gap:var(--brand-spacing_4,1rem)}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__cta__lg0vS{flex-direction:row;gap:var(--brand-spacing_2,.5rem);justify-content:center}}.HomePage_marketing-homepage-hero__reviews__mnICs{padding:0;background:transparent}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__reviews__mnICs{margin-top:var(--brand-spacing_2,.5rem)}}.HomePage_marketing-homepage-hero__ratings__UkByR{flex-direction:row;gap:var(--brand-spacing_4,1rem)}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__ratings__UkByR{gap:var(--brand-spacing_16,4rem)}}.HomePage_marketing-homepage-hero__items__fNoZo{grid-template-columns:none;grid-gap:var(--brand-spacing_1,.25rem)}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__items__fNoZo{display:flex;gap:var(--brand-spacing_3,.75rem);justify-content:center;align-items:center}}.HomePage_marketing-homepage-hero__score__axN_G{color:var(--marketing-forest-green-800,#006a43);fill:var(--marketing-forest-green-800,#006a43);justify-self:center}.HomePage_marketing-homepage-hero__logo__CesOo{height:100%}.HomePage_marketing-homepage-hero__logo__CesOo,.HomePage_marketing-homepage-hero__logo__CesOo img{width:90px;max-height:30px}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__logo__CesOo,.HomePage_marketing-homepage-hero__logo__CesOo img{width:150px;max-height:50px}}.HomePage_marketing-homepage-hero__star__4g2IY{gap:var(--brand-spacing_1,.25rem)}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__star__4g2IY{gap:.375rem}.HomePage_marketing-homepage-hero__star__4g2IY svg{height:16px;width:16px}}.HomePage_marketing-homepage-hero__media__M7hTs{width:311px;height:178px;display:flex}@media screen and (min-width:640px){.HomePage_marketing-homepage-hero__media__M7hTs{width:455px;height:259px}}@media screen and (min-width:1024px){.HomePage_marketing-homepage-hero__media__M7hTs{height:422px;width:718px}}@media screen and (min-width:1280px){.HomePage_marketing-homepage-hero__media__M7hTs{height:500px;width:850px}}.HomePage_marketing-homepage-hero__media__M7hTs iframe,.HomePage_marketing-homepage-hero__media__M7hTs img{width:100%;height:100%}.HomePage_marketing-homepage-hero__media__M7hTs img{-o-object-fit:contain;object-fit:contain}.TestimonialBlock_testimonial-slider__6IIdF{display:flex;flex-direction:column;gap:24px}.TestimonialBlock_testimonial-slider__content__gVdTg{display:flex;justify-content:center;align-items:center;min-height:580px}@media (min-width:375px){.TestimonialBlock_testimonial-slider__content__gVdTg{min-height:530px}}@media (min-width:640px){.TestimonialBlock_testimonial-slider__content__gVdTg{min-height:460px}}@media (min-width:1024px){.TestimonialBlock_testimonial-slider__content__gVdTg{min-height:630px}}@media (min-width:1056px){.TestimonialBlock_testimonial-slider__content__gVdTg{min-height:615px}}@media (min-width:1200px){.TestimonialBlock_testimonial-slider__content__gVdTg{min-height:495px}}@media (min-width:1320px){.TestimonialBlock_testimonial-slider__content__gVdTg{min-height:470px}}@media (min-width:1536px){.TestimonialBlock_testimonial-slider__content__gVdTg{min-height:555px}}.TestimonialBlock_testimonial-slider__text__HHmlg{color:var(--marketing-charcoal-grey-900,#1b1b1b)}.TestimonialBlock_testimonial-slider__wrapper__niPRM{display:flex;flex-direction:column;align-items:center}.TestimonialBlock_testimonial-slider__controls__MDHX5{display:flex;justify-content:space-between;align-items:center;width:100%}.TestimonialBlock_testimonial-slider__indicators__CkoGB{display:flex;align-items:center;gap:var(--brand-spacing_3,.75rem)}.TestimonialBlock_testimonial-slider__circle__whtFh{height:10px;width:10px;border-radius:var(--brand-rounded-x3,.75rem);border:1px solid var(--marketing-forest-green-800,#006a43)}.TestimonialBlock_testimonial-slider__circle--forest-green__5rqyv{border-color:var(--marketing-white,#fff)}.TestimonialBlock_testimonial-slider__circle--iris-purple__oIH1B{border-color:var(--marketing-iris-purple-900,#3b3585)}.TestimonialBlock_testimonial-slider__circle--coral-orange__SY8aP{border-color:var(--marketing-coral-orange-800,#bc4f2d)}.TestimonialBlock_testimonial-slider__circle--aqua-teal__OzT9o{border-color:var(--marketing-aqua-teal-800,#116b6b)}.TestimonialBlock_testimonial-slider__circle--peony-pink__BD9fy{border-color:var(--marketing-peony-pink-900,#b22557)}.TestimonialBlock_testimonial-slider__circle--active__toqF8{width:16px;height:16px;border:none;background-color:var(--marketing-forest-green-800,#006a43)}.TestimonialBlock_testimonial-slider__circle--active--forest-green__zuISM{background-color:var(--marketing-mint-green-300,#c0ffa5)}.TestimonialBlock_testimonial-slider__circle--active--iris-purple__RJDs3{background-color:var(--marketing-iris-purple-900,#3b3585)}.TestimonialBlock_testimonial-slider__circle--active--coral-orange__Er8XI{background-color:var(--marketing-coral-orange-800,#bc4f2d)}.TestimonialBlock_testimonial-slider__circle--active--aqua-teal__t1qnk{background-color:var(--marketing-aqua-teal-800,#116b6b)}.TestimonialBlock_testimonial-slider__circle--active--peony-pink__uzeRo{background-color:var(--marketing-peony-pink-900,#b22557)}